Vyasanasametham Bandhumithradhikal

Comedy Drama Malayalam


Savithri is a broadminded woman from a middle class family. She has two daughters and four grandchildren. Among them she is especially close to her eldest granddaughter Anjali. Savithri dreams of a happy and independent married life for Anjali. However Anjali gets cold feet due to an unexpected death during her marriage arrangement.

Cast:Anaswara Rajan, Siju Sunny, Mallika Sukumaran, Azees Nedumangad, Joemon Jyothir, Baiju Santhosh
Director:Vipin S
Writer:Vipin S
Editor:John Kutty
Camera:Rahim Abubacker

A Hilarious Tragicomedy With Pitch-Perfect Casting

FCG Member Reviewer Vishal Menon
Vishal Menon | The Hollywood Reporter India
Mon, June 30 2025

Each of the film's sub-plots has been written around one broad joke, but the casting is so perfect that we’re constantly looking forward to the reactions of these actors

When Vipin Das, the producer of Vyasana Sametham Bandhu Mithradhikal (With Condolences, Friends and Relatives), last directed a film, he made Guruvayoor Ambalanadayil (2024), a hilarious confusion-comedy that culminated in a million things going wrong at a wedding. The hit comedy was something a master like Priyadarshan would have been proud to call his own. But if he were to watch Vyasana Sametham Bandhu Mithradhikal, he’d be prouder. Made by another Vipin (S Vipin), he borrows the chaos of a Priyadarshan-esque comedy and plants it within a dark comedic setting that is already primed for the wildest of laughs. So, instead of a wedding like in his guru’s film, Vipin sets up his comedy on the day on which the film’s protagonist Anjali’s (Anaswara Rajan) grandmother passes away. What makes the timing impeccably imperfect is that she’s just a week away from getting engaged to her toxic fiancé. On one hand, you feel deeply for Anjali for having lost the one person in the family she connected strongly to; in the other hand, her grandmother’s passing is a blessing in disguise, giving her hope that she can get out of a marriage she was never interested in.
